      Economic boost follows Taylor Swift's Eras Tour

      Taylor Swift's concerts have posted significant boosts to the economies of every city where she's performed this tour. In Toronto, hosting six Taylor Swift concerts in a row will be like hosting six Super Bowls in a row, one expert says.
